Signs That a Tree Needs to Be Removed
Older trees, which are prevalent in Smithfield, are more susceptible to disease, general wear and tear, and damage. You may need these trees removed if you find:
- The trunk branches off in different directions into multiple large , heavy branches
- Rot , dead branches , missing bark or leaves , and other signs of decay
- Cracks in the trunk , especially deep cracks
- Cracking between branches , especially large heavy ones
- Fungus or mold
When you see a tree leaning or detect raised dirt around the base, you should arrange an immediate evaluation, as it is at a greater risk of falling. You may also need to have a tree evaluated if it’s growing too close to your home or to utility lines — many communities and utility companies have their own standards for how close a tree can get.
Do Tree Removal Companies Need to be Licensed in Pennsylvania?
Pennsylvania does not have specific licensing requirements for tree removal companies, but it’s important to check with your local municipal government to ensure your provider meets the requirements in your area. Select a reputable company that carries both workers compensation and liability insurance. You may feel more at ease entrusting your tree removal needs to a licensed general contractor. An individual can also become a licensed arborist through the International Society of Arboriculture (ISA). While not required, this certification indicates that an individual is trained in all aspects of arboriculture and follows the ISA’s code of ethics. Consult your tree removal provider before cutting, but typically, you can hold onto the wood from trees cut down on your property. If you don’t want to keep the wood, ask your tree removal company if they'll remove it, or contact your local waste removal department to find the best way to remove it.
